1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What was one factor that helped turn the Great Plains into the Dust Bowl in the 1930s?
Back
intense drought in the region
Answer explanation
The intense drought in the region was a major factor that turned the Great Plains into the Dust Bowl in the 1930s.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which statement best describes how investment in the stock market during the mid to late 1920s contributed to the Great Depression? Options: people weren't able to repay the loans used to purchase stocks, Government taxes on stock transactions made it difficult to repay investors, financial institutions were not required to report earnings to stop investors, foreign countries were not required to immediately pay stockholder earnings
Back
people weren't able to repay the loans used to purchase stocks
Answer explanation
Investors during the 1920s couldn't repay stock purchase loans, leading to the Great Depression.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How did the Great Depression affect American society?
Back
Businesses were forced to close causing widespread unemployment.
Answer explanation
The Great Depression caused businesses to close, leading to widespread unemployment.

6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the purpose of the Securities and Exchange Commission?
Back
to maintain Fair markets and increase investor confidence in financial institutions
Answer explanation
The purpose of the Securities and Exchange Commission is to maintain fair markets and increase investor confidence in financial institutions.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which New Deal program still in existence today provides an income for retired people?
Back
Social Security Administration
Answer explanation
The Social Security Administration is the New Deal program that provides an income for retired people.
